Nellis AFB 9/11 remembrance ceremony

Chief Master Sgt. Alex Morgan, 99th Air Base Wing command chief, gives a speech on his experience as a guest speaker during the 9/11 remembrance ceremony at Nellis Air Force Base, Nevada, Sept. 10, 2021. Morgan said the 2,977 people who lost their lives, including 445 first responders who selflessly sacrificed themselves saving countless others, were the first casualties in the Global War on Terror.
